当我创建一个应用程序时,我按照指定放置了URL,它提供了以下内容:
错误应用域:http://coolapp.hobbycraftstore.com/不是有效域。为什么不有效?我也尝试了域名http // coolfbapp.com /,这也不起作用
答案 0 :(得分:1)
域名不包含协议!所以只需删除http://就可以了:
domain: coolapp.hobbycraftstore.com
原作者绝对正确。然而,即使看到这些信息的其他答案,我仍然得到错误,不知道为什么。
在张贴的其他答案的帮助下,我终于开始工作了。以下是包含适用于我的完整解决方案的步骤。
在Facebook开发页面“Apps-YourAppName”中,点击LEFT Nav中的Basic。
此页面共有3个部分:基本信息,云服务和“选择应用与Facebook集成的方式”
在选择应用与Facebook的整合方式部分,选择“网站”
在“站点URL”对话框中输入完全限定的域名。示例:http://www.mydomain.com或http://mydomain.com(我的网站不包含www,所以我没有添加它。)
点击页面底部的“保存更改”按钮。您可能会收到通知,可能需要几分钟才能等等等等......但您可以立即继续执行后续步骤。
现在,在此屏幕顶部的“基本信息”部分中,您现在可以添加App域。这应该格式化为mydomain.com。不要添加“http://”,也不要在域名末尾添加“/”。
注意:我的网站不使用www,因此我无法确认步骤#6中是否需要。如果您不确定,请尝试两种方式。
点击页面底部的“保存更改”按钮。您可能会收到通知,可能需要几分钟才能等等等等......但您可以立即继续执行后续步骤。
此时错误未显示为之前。
希望这有帮助!